Before I go back to the boss and tell him he’s dreaming I want to double check here, the maximum outputs that an M32 can support is 16 isn’t it? Whether you have one DL attached or two, you can’t expand it out to 32 outputs because the software doesn’t support it.
 
That depends on what you mean by "outputs".
Internally there are only 16 buses + L/R/C so, yes, only 16 "unique mixes" + L/R/C

The buses can also be routed to Matrix buses for additional processing. Those Matrix buses can then be routed to physical outputs.
Nearly any internal signal can be routed to one or more physical outputs: XLR, AES50, or Ultranet.

You can get 32 outputs out via USB to a DAW or editor don't forget, and these are pretty customisable in what goes where.
 
There are also eight auxiliary outs - sort of. There are 4 mono TRS balanced 1/4" outs labeled aux 1 - 4 and, and a stereo 5 -6 that also has RCA outs. The same configuration is available as aux inputs. Aux 7 - 8 only send to (and return from) the internal USB recorder. These are line level and do not include mic preamps.
